#2f08b5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f08b5 is composed of 18.4% red, 3.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74% cyan, 95.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 253.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 37.1%. #2f08b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e10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#2f08b5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010c is the darkest color, while #faf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f08b5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5865 is the less saturated color, while #2b01bc is the most saturated one.
